Current OU SCM major. This is spot on. I would consider what type or sector of job you want too. OU MIS absolutely prepares you for a business environment either way but has many connections and increased reputations in certain sectors, just as other colleges do. (oil, gas, energy, certain defense)

OU MIS will teach you coding languages like C# and will introduce you to SQL, PBI, etc while still having a business background (accounting, marketing, supply chain etc). I have friends in the MIS major graduating within the next year and they are signed on with various companies in FL, CA, TX, KS, MO, OK, NC.

along with this… i will add i am very close with many of the law professors and know the previous dean at OU. A LOT of their JD candidates are political science or criminal justice and they- like med schools- want diversity in majors, especially if you want any kind of financial aid. previous dean told me that there is actually a female accounting undergraduate scholarship that went untouched in previous years and many business law scholarships that just don’t meet amounts of business law focused undergraduates. likewise with med school, my uncle got in as a humanities major and so so stats. definitely not to say they won’t accept you or anything, just be wary because it’s about LSAT or MCAT and undergraduates stats (clubs, leadership, GPA). just make sure you are allocating time for that plus volunteer or hospital hours if you are considering MD or DO.
